TheAérospatiale Alouette III (French pronunciation:[alwɛt],Lark; company designationsSA 316 andSA 319) is a single-engine, lightutility helicopter developed by French aircraft companySud Aviation. Introduced in the early 1960s, more than 2,000 units were built during its production run that extended for six decades.
The Alouette III was developed as an enlarged derivative of the earlier successfulAlouette II. It shared many design elements with its predecessor while offering an extra pair of seats and other refinements. It quickly became a commercial success and was operated by a range of civil and military customers. Further variants were also developed; amongst these was a high-altitude derivative, designated as theSA 315B Lama, which entered operational service during July 1971. The Alouette III was principally manufactured byAérospatiale, after its take over of Sud Aviation in 1970. The type was also built by variouslicensed manufacturers such asHindustan Aeronautics Limited in India (asHAL Chetak), byIndustria Aeronautică Română in Romania (asIAR 316), and byEidgenössisches Flugzeugwerk in Switzerland (asF+W Emmen).
Similar to the Alouette II, in military service, it was used to perform missions such asaerial observation andphotography,air-sea rescue, communication liaison,transport, and training. It could also be armed withanti-tank missiles, anti-shiptorpedoes, and a fixedcannon. In a civilian capacity, the helicopter was commonly used forcasualty evacuation (often fitted with a pair of external stretcher panniers),crop spraying, personnel transportation, and for carrying other external loads.
By the 2010s, many operators were in the process of drawing down their fleets and replacing them with more modern types; theFrench Armed Forces intended to replace their Alouette IIIs with the newly developedAirbus Helicopters H160 and theIndian Armed Forces with theHAL Dhruvs.
The Alouette III has its origins with an earlier helicopter design by French aircraft manufacturerSud-Est, theSE 3120 Alouette, which, while breaking several helicopter speed and distance records in July 1953, was deemed to have been too complex to be realistic commercial product.[1][2] Having received financial backing from the French government, which had taken an official interest in the venture, the earlier design was used as a starting point for a new rotorcraft that would harness the newly developedturboshaft engine; only a few years prior,Joseph Szydlowski, the founder ofTurbomeca, had successfully managed to develop theArtouste, a 260 hp (190 kW) single shaft turbine engine derived from hisOrédon turbine engine. An improved version of this engine was combined with the revised design to quickly produce a new helicopter, initially known as theSE 3130 Alouette II.[1][3][4]
During April 1956, the first production Alouette II was completed, becoming the first production turbine-powered helicopter in the world.[1] The innovative light helicopter soon broke several world records and became a commercial success.[5][6] As a result of the huge demand for the Alouette II, manufacturer Sud Aviation took a great interest in the development of derivatives, as well as the more general ambition of embarking on further advancement in the field of rotorcraft.[7]
In accordance with these goals, the company decided to commit itself to a new development programme with the aim of developing a more powerful helicopter that would be capable of accommodating up to 7 seats or a pair ofstretchers. The design team was managed by Frenchaerospace engineerRené Mouille.[7][8][9] The design produced, designated as the "SE 3160", featured several improvements over the Alouette II; efforts were made to provide for a higher level of external visibility for the pilot as well as for greater aerodynamic efficiency via the adoption of a highlystreamlined exterior.[7]

On 28 February 1959, the first prototype SE 3160 performed itsmaiden flight, piloted by French aviatorJean Boulet.[7][8] Shortly thereafter, the SE 3160 would become more commonly known as the Alouette III. During its flight test programme, the prototype demonstrated its high altitude capabilities on several occasions; in June 1959, it landed at an altitude of over 4,000 metres in theMont Blanc mountain range and, during October 1960, it was able to achieve the same feat at an altitude more than 6,000 metres in theHimalayas. During these attempts, it was flown by Jean Boulet, who was accompanied by a pair of passengers and 250 kg of equipment.[7]
During 1961, the initial SE 3160 model of the type entered serial production.[7] On 15 December 1961, the Alouette III received itsairworthiness certificate, clearing it to enter operational service. Despite an order placed by theFrench Army for an initial batch of 50 Alouette IIIs during June 1961, the first two customers of the rotorcraft were in fact export sales, having been sold outside of France.[7] The Alouette III was specifically designed to fly at high altitudes, as such, it quickly earned a reputation for its favourable characteristics during rescue operations. According to its manufacturer, it was the first helicopter to present an effective multi-mission capability and performance to match with its diverse mission range in both civil or military circles.[7]
The SE 3160 model continued to be produced until 1968, when it was replaced by the refined "SA 316B" model.[7] (After its production ended, the SE 3160 has sometimes been retroactively redesignated "SA 316A", but its original SE 3160 designation is more commonly used, especially in older sources.) Both the SE 3160 and the SA 316B were powered by a more powerful version of the Artouste engine, the Artouste IIIB, whose turbine was rated to produce 858 horsepower (640 kW), though because of the limits of the engine's reduction gearbox, the Artouste IIIB was de-rated to generate 563 horsepower (420 kW) in service. The later "SA 319B" variant adopted the more fuel-efficientTurbomeca Astazou XIVB engine, extending its range and endurance; on 10 July 1967, the Astazou-powered Alouette III performed its first flight.[7] During 1979, the 1,437th Alouette III departed from the company's assembly line inMarignane, France, after which the main production line was closed down as a consequence of diminishing demand for the type. During 1985, the final French-produced Alouette III was delivered.[7] It had been produced from 1961 to 1985 in France, however, license production continued.[10]

Despite the closure of Aérospatiale 's own production line, the event was not the end of the type's manufacturing activity. Over 500 Alouette IIIs are recorded as having been manufactured under licence abroad in several countries, such as Romania, India, and Switzerland.[7][11] Various versions of the Alouette III were also either licence-built or otherwise assembled by IAR in Romania (as theIAR 316), F+W Emmen (de) in Switzerland, byFokker and Lichtwerk in theNetherlands, and in India as the HAL Chetak.[7][12] The Romanian IAR 316, was an Aérospatiale SA 316B Alouette III license produced from 1971 to 1987, with 250 made with about half for Romania and half for export.[13] Additionally, Romania also developed the IAR 317 Airfox, an attack helicopter version of the IAR 316;at least one prototype was made and was debuted at the 1985Paris Air Show.[14]
Hindustan Aeronautics Limited (HAL) obtained a licence to construct the Alouette III, which was known locally as theChetak, at their own production facilities in India.[7] More than 300 units were built by HAL; the company has continued to independently update and indigenise the helicopter over the decades. A modernised variant of the Chetak has remained production, though at a diminished volume, into the 21st century. The latest HAL Chetak was delivered in 2021, and also included updated avionics.[11] Over 350 Chetak had been produced the 2020s.[15]

TheArgentine Naval Aviation operated a total of 14 Alouette III helicopters. A single SA316B was on board theARA General Belgrano when she was sunk bytorpedoes fired byHMS Conqueror during the 1982Falklands War with the United Kingdom. A second Alouette III played an important role during the ArgentineInvasion of South Georgia. On 2 December 2010, the last example was retired at a ceremony held at BANComandante Espora,Bahía Blanca.[16][17]
Between April 1964 and 1967, a small batch of Alouette IIIs were delivered from France in a disassembled state to Australia. Following their assembly, these were used by theRoyal Australian Air Force (RAAF) at theWoomera Rocket Range for light passenger transport purpose and to assist in the recovery of missile parts in the aftermath of test launches conducted at the Range.[18]
Between 1967-69 Austria acquired 12 SE3160 Alouette IIIs, which were upgraded to version SE316B. They are used for liaison and transport purposes and still play a vital role in rescue missions in the high mountains of Austria with their side-mounted hook. They are stationed inAigen im Ennstal,Klagenfurt andSchwaz in Tirol.[19] Austria planned to decommission them beginning in 2023, and they were to be replaced by the Leonardo AW169M.[20] In addition to the original order, three more used Alouette III were acquired from other forces to replace attrition.[21]

Indian civilian authorities and theIndian Air Force donated aDC-3 Dakota, aTwin Otter, and a Alouette III helicopter to theBangladesh Air Force, during theBangladesh Liberation War in 1971.[22] The aircraft were engaged to take advantage of the lack of night-fighting capability of thePakistan Air Force, and to launch hit-and-run attacks on sensitive targets inside East Pakistan.[23] The Alouette helicopter was extensively modified with a 1 in (25 mm) steel plate welded to its floor for extra protection, and fitted with 14 rockets from pylons attached to its side and.303 Browning machine guns. The helicopter was operated by a three member crew consisting of Squadron Leader Sultan Mahmood, Flight Lieutenant Bodiul Alam, and Captain Shahabuddin, all of whom were awarded heBir Uttam gallantry award.[citation needed]
During 1977, theChilean Navy ordered a batch of ten SA-319Bs. These rotorcraft, which were delivered by the middle of 1978, were only made operational just before the peak of theBeagle conflict between Chile and neighbouring Argentina. The Alouette III was the first real organic maritime ship borne tactical helicopter to be operated by Chile's naval forces; for this role, they were equipped with a radar and armed with rockets, guns, depth charges and a single light anti-submarine torpedo.[citation needed]
During the frantic training period in 1978 to meet wartime needs, a sole SA-319B was accidentally damaged, leading to it being placed in storage and subsequently repaired back to an airworthy condition years later. All ten Chilean Navy SA-319Bs were operational and in excellent conditions by the end of the 1980s, shortly after which they were replaced by larger SA532 Super Puma helicopters, and were bought by civilian operators.[citation needed]
Between 1962 and 1967, a total of 8 Alouette IIIs were delivered to theRoyal Danish Navy. They were primarily tasked with SAR and reconnaissance in support of the navy's Arctic patrol ships. During 1982, they were replaced by a batch of BritishWestland Lynx.[24]


During early 1960, the Alouette III officially entered squadron service with the French armed forces. In June 1971, having been suitably impressed by the type's performance so far, the French Army elected to order a force of 50 Alouette IIIs for their own purposes.[citation needed] Amongst the most noteworthy uses that France applied the type to was the first use of helicopter-basedanti-tank missiles in the form of theNord AS.11MCLOSwire-guided missile.[25]
During June 1960, an Alouette III carrying seven people successfully performed both take-offs and landings onMont Blanc in theFrench Alps at an altitude of 4,810 metres (15,780 feet), an unprecedented altitude for such activities by a helicopter at the time.[26] The same helicopter again demonstrated the type's extraordinary performance in November 1960 by making take-offs and landings with a crew of two and apayload of 250 kg (551 lbs) in theHimalayas at an altitude of 6,004 metres (19,698 feet).[26]
During June 2004, the Alouette III was retired from the French Air Force after 32 years of successful service, having been entirely replaced by the newer twin-enginedEurocopter EC 355 Ecureuil 2. The French Army also withdrew the last of their examples during 2013 in favour of more modern rotorcraft such as theAirbus Helicopters H160.[27]
By 2017, the French Navy were still using the Alouette III in a reduced capacity, nonetheless being used to routinely conduct both Search and Rescue and logistics missions.[28] Since the 1970s, the type has gradually been supplanted by the largerEurocopter AS365 Dauphin, and later on, by the specialisedEurocopter AS565 Panther as an anti-submarine warfare platform. The use of twin-engined rotorcraft in the maritime environment has become somewhat of an expected standard, one which the single-engined Alouette III cannot satisfy, putting the type at an obvious disadvantage.[27] During January 2018, it was announced that the French Navy would be replacing its remaining Alouette IIIs with rentedAérospatiale SA 330 Pumas as a stop-gap measure; this decision was reportedly taken due to its increasing unreliability, rapidly inflating operating costs, and the sheer age of the fleet.[27][29] However, as of 2021 the Alouette III was still reported to be in service.[30] The aircraft was finally withdrawn from French Navy service in June 2022.[31] It had been in service for 60 years and was in active use right to the end, with the last three ending their service at the end of December.[32] The aircraft was long known for ease of maintenance, which aided its use overseas, however and the end of its life it was requiring increasing maintenance hours and it was becoming hard to get spare parts which were no longer in production. The aircraft was still be used for training, interdiction missions, and shorter range mission.[32]

During 1963, the first pair of Alouette IIIs were delivered to theIrish Air Corps; a third rotorcraft arrived in 1964 and a batch of five further aircraft were delivered between 1972 and 1974. The service ultimately operated a total of eight Alouette IIIs between 1963 and 2007; throughout much of this period, they were the only helicopters operated by the Corps.[citation needed]
On 21 September 2007, the Alouette III was formally retired from the Irish Air Corps during a ceremony held atBaldonnel Aerodrome. During 44 years of successful service, the Irish Alouette III fleet amassed over 77,000 flying hours. As well as routine military missions, the aircraft undertook some 1,717search-and-rescue missions, saving 542 lives and flew a further 2,882air ambulance flights. The oldest of the Alouettes, 195, is kept in 'rotors running' condition for the Air Corps Museum.[33]

Under a licensing arrangement between Aérospatiale and HAL, the Alouette III was built by HAL and was known asHAL Chetak. HAL manufactured more than 350 of these, the majority of these were acquired by theIndian Armed Forces. The helicopters were used to perform various mission roles, including training, transport,casualty evacuation, communications and liaison roles.[34] After theGovernment of India constituted theIndian Army Aviation Corps in 1986, majority of the Chetaks previously operated by the Indian Air Force were transferred to theIndian Army on 1 November 1986. The Air Force continued to fly a limited number of armed Chetaks for evacuation and attack missions.[34] The Chetaks were widely used in India's armed conflicts and multinational operations such asOperation Khukri in 2000.[35]
During the 2010s, the Chetak was replaced by theHAL Dhruv in the armed forces, and the Chetaks were widely used for training, and light utility roles.[36] In 2013, HAL unveiled a new variant, named asHAL Chetan, which included an upgraded HAL/Turbomecca TM 333-2M2 Shakti engine.[37] In 2017, theIndian Navy initiated plans for procuring a replacement for the type.[38] However, an additional contract for eight helicopters were signed in 2017,[39] the last of which was delivered in 2021.[11]
In the 1970s, Chetak helicopters were decorated with animal motifs and presented at the annual Republic day parades. The helicopters decorated like elephants have become iconic in India, and known as names such as "dancing elephant helicopters" and "flying elephants".[40][41]
HAL also exported the Chetak helicopters to nations such as Namibia and Suriname.[42] India also donated helicopters to other countries such as Bangladesh and Nepal.[43]
TheIndonesian Army Aviation received seven Alouette III in 1969, replacing theirMil Mi-4 which were grounded due to lack of spare parts.[44] Their first combat operations was mopping up theSarawak communist insurgents in Riam Sejawak,West Kalimantan Province.[45] The Indonesian Army sent three Alouette III to participate in theIndonesian invasion of East Timor in 1975 and its subsequent counter-guerilla operations, performing combat search-and-rescue and reconnaissance roles.[46] In 2003, the Indonesian Army still has a single operational Alouette III.[47]
During the early 1960s the Alouette III replaced theHiller OH-23 Raven of theNetherlands Armed Forces.[48]Later it also replaced the Alouette IIs of theRoyal Netherlands Air Force.[48] A total of 77 Alouette IIIs were ordered in batches over the years, with 27 being built in license by NV Lichtwerk inHoogeveen.[48] The Alouette III served for 51 years in the Netherlands Armed Force before being retired in 2016.[48]

During the 1960s, Pakistan purchased a fleet of 35 Alouette III helicopters to equip thePakistan Air Force (PAF). These saw active combat during theIndo-Pakistani War of 1971, in which the type was mainly used for liaison and VIP-transport missions. In 2010, it was announced that Switzerland had come to an agreement with Pakistan for a number of ex-Swiss Alouette IIIs to be donated to the PAF; however, the terms of this agreement restricts their usage to performing search and rescue and disaster relief operations. Pakistan Navy started operating Alouette III helicopters in 1977. The helicopters are still in service and have a long history of flying laurels.[49]

Portugal was the first country to use the Alouette III in combat. In 1963, during theOverseas Wars inAngola,Mozambique andPortuguese Guinea, Portugal began using Alouette IIIs in combat, mainly inair assault andmedevac operations, where it proved its qualities. Besides the basic transport version (code namedcanibal, plural canibais), Portugal used a special version of the Alouette III with aMG 151 20 mmautocannon mounted in the rear in order to fire from the left side door; it was designatedhelicanhão (heli-cannon) and code namedlobo mau (big bad wolf).
In the Overseas Wars, the Portuguese usually launched air assaults with groups of six or seven Alouette III: five or sixcanibais – each usually carrying fiveparatroopers orcommandos – and alobo mau heli-cannon. The Portuguese practice was for the troops to jump from thecanibais when the helicopters were hovering two-three metres above the ground – famous images of these disembarking troops became an iconic image of the war. The landing of the troops was covered by thelobo mau. While the troops performed the ground assault, thecanibais moved away from the combat zone, while thelobo mau stayed to provide fire support, destroying enemy resistance and concentration points with the fire from its 20 mm autocannon. Once the ground combat had finished, thecanibais returned; firstly to collect the wounded, then the rest of the troops.
In April 2020, the last of Portugal's SE3160 Alouette IIIs were withdrawn from service, the type having been replaced by fiveAgustaWestland AW119 Koala.[50][51]

In 1977, theRepublic of Korea Navy started operating 12 Alouette IIIs.[52] It was typically dispatched aboard several destroyers in an anti-submarine capacity. On 13 August 1983, the Republic of Korea Navy discovered a naval vessel of theKorean People's Army that had entering their sea. A single Alouette III engaged the spy ship and destroyed it using anAS.12 missile;[52] following the mission, the specific helicopter involved received avictory marking, which was the only aircraft to receive such a mark in the entireRepublic of Korea Armed Forces. The Alouette III was also operated as a rescue helicopter, responding to major incidents such as the crash ofAsiana Airlines Flight 733 inMokpo,Republic of Korea, on 26 July 1993.
Following the introduction of theWestland Lynx during the early 1990s, the Alouette IIIs were diverted to secondary roles, such as training, and were gradually phased out of service. A substantial number were withdrawn in 2006. South Korea's remaining Alouette IIIs were withdrawn from service in December 2019.[52]
The nation ofRhodesia emerged as a prolific user of both the Alouette II and its enlarged sibling, the Alouette III.[53] Early operations were flown with an emphasis on its use by theRhodesian Army andBritish South Africa Police, includingparamilitary and aerial reconnaissance operations. Throughout the 1960s, the type progressively spread into additional roles, includingaerial supply,casualty evacuation, communications relays, and troop-transports.[54] Rhodesian aerial operations would typically involve flying under relatively high and hot conditions, which reduced the efficiency of aircraft in general; however, the Alouette II proved to be both hardy and relatively resistant to battle damage.[55] In order to extend the inadequate range of the type, fuel caches were strategically deployed across the country to be used for refuelling purposes.[54]

At its peak, No. 7 Squadron of the Rhodesian Air Force operated a force of 34 Alouette IIIs, which would normally operate in conjunction with a smaller number of Alouette IIs. They played a major part in the Rhodesian Forces'Fireforce doctrine, in which they would rapidly deploy ground troops, function as aerial observation and command posts, and provide mobile fire support as armed gunships.[56] In order to improve performance, Rhodesia's Alouette fleet was subject to extensive modifications during its service life, including changes to their refueling apparatus, gun sights, and cabin fittings, along with the installation of additional armouring and armaments.[57]
Over time, theRhodesian Security Forces developed an innovative deployment tactic of rapidly encircling and enveloping enemies, known as theFireforce, for which the Alouette II was a core component.[53] The quick-reaction Fireforce battalions were typically centred atCentenary andMount Darwin; however, a deliberate emphasis was placed on locating both rotorcraft and troops as close to a current or anticipated theatre of operations as would be feasibly possible.[58]

The Alouette III served for over 44 years in theSouth African Air Force (SAAF); it is believed that 121 examples were acquired between 1962 and 1975 for the service from France.[59] During 1966, by which point the SAAF had built up a fleet of around 50 Alouette IIIs already, it was decided to dispatch several of the type to support ground troops stationed inSouth West Africa attempting to contain the emergingSouth West African People's Organisation (SWAPO); this would be the beginnings of what would become the lengthySouth African Border War.[59] The type saw considerable action during the conflict; while initially used for more passive operations such asaerial reconnaissance, from July 1967 onwards, Alouette III participated in active combat missions as well. It was frequently employed as a support platform for performing South African counterstrike operations inside neighbouringNamibia andAngola.[60] Reportedly, a total of eight Alouette IIIs had been listed as having been lost over the conflict zone by the end of the war.[59]
By 1990, there were a total of 70 Alouette III helicopters remaining in active service.[59] Throughout the course of its service life with the SAAF, the Alouette III fleet was recorded as having accumulated more than 346,000 flight hours. During June 2006, the last Alouette III was officially withdrawn from SAAF service at a ceremony held atAFB Swartkop, nearPretoria.[60]
During January 2013, reports emerged that South African defense officials were in the process of planning to transfer some of the retired fleet, along with spare parts and associated support equipment, to theZimbabwean Air Force; South African newspaperMail & Guardian claimed that the rotorcraft could be used to sway politics in the nation in favour of the incumbentPresident,Robert Mugabe.[61] However, during February 2013, an interimcourt order was issued which blocked the proposed sale of South African Alouette IIIs to Zimbabwe.[62] In February 2014, reports emerged that South Africa now intended to sell part of the ex-SAAF fleet toNamibia instead.[63]
During 1986, the South American country of Suriname purchased a pair of secondhand Alouette III helicopters from Portugal. During 1999, theSurinam Air Force opted to retire and sell off its Alouette III helicopters. In their place, three newly built HAL Chetaks (an Indian version of the Alouette IIIs) were delivered to the Suriname Air Force on 13 March 2015, while the pilots and technicians of the Surinam Air Force underwent training on the type in Bangalore, India for some time.[64][65][66]

During 1964, theSwiss Air Force opted to procure a batch of nine Alouette III rotorcraft directly from Aérospatiale; further orders included one placed in 1966 for 15 more. In addition, a total of 60 SA-316Bs (often referred to as theF+W Alouette IIIS) were licence-assembled byF+W Emmen in Switzerland.[citation needed]
During 2004, theSwiss Armed Forces announced the expected withdrawal of the Alouette III from front-line service would commence by 2006 and that it was to be entirely retired by 2010; they have been replaced by a smaller force of 20 new-builtEurocopter EC635s.[67] Since their retirement, at least 10 ex-Swiss Alouettes have been gifted to Pakistan to perform search and rescue operations.[49]
